Choosing the right meat thermometer for BBQ is essential for any grill master aiming to achieve restaurant-quality results at home. BBQ isn't just about firing up the grill; it's a precise art that demands monitoring internal temperatures to avoid overcooking or undercooking your brisket, ribs, or burgers. A reliable meat thermometer for BBQ prevents guesswork, reduces food safety risks like bacterial growth, and elevates your outdoor cooking game. Without one, you're relying on unreliable methods like poking or timing, which often lead to dry, tough meats or unsafe eats.
The challenges of BBQ-specific use are unique: high-heat environments near open flames, long smoking sessions that require remote monitoring, and the need for quick, accurate reads without opening the lid too often. For BBQ enthusiasts, a meat thermometer must withstand heat up to 700°F or more, offer wireless connectivity for hands-free operation, and provide multi-probe options to track meat and ambient grill temps simultaneously. Key factors to consider include response time (ideally under 5 seconds for instant reads), probe durability, battery life for extended cooks, app integration for alerts, and water resistance for easy cleanup after saucy sessions. Waterproof designs and magnetic backs for grill attachment are bonuses in smoky, outdoor settings.

The MEATER Plus stands out as the best overall meat thermometer for BBQ due to its true wireless design and robust app integration, perfect for monitoring long smokes without constant lid lifts. With a 165-foot Bluetooth range and ambient sensor tracking grill temps up to 1000°F, it ensures precise control over your brisket or pork shoulder. Key features include a 24+ hour battery life, five-meat presets with USDA-approved doneness alerts, and a sleek, subscription-free app for iOS/Android that graphs temp trends.
Pros: Exceptional accuracy (±1°F), dishwasher-safe probes, and seamless connectivity make it ideal for pitmasters who multitask. Cons: Higher price point and occasional app glitches in weak signal areas.
Choose this if you're serious about BBQ and want a hassle-free, tech-savvy tool that delivers pro-level results on any smoker or grill.

For budget-conscious BBQ fans, the ThermoPro TP03 offers unbeatable value as an instant-read meat thermometer tailored for quick grill checks. Its ultra-fast 3-5 second response time shines during high-heat searing sessions, helping you pull burgers or steaks at peak juiciness without overcooking. The foldable probe with 4.3-inch length reaches deep into thick cuts, while the backlit LCD and auto-rotating display ensure readability in smoky conditions. Waterproof and magnetized, it's built to handle BBQ splatters and sticks easily to your grill.
Pros: Affordable under $20, accurate to ±0.9°F, and motion-sensing auto-off saves batteries. Cons: Wired design requires close proximity, not ideal for remote monitoring in long smokes.
This is perfect for casual weekend grillers who need a reliable, no-frills meat thermometer for BBQ on a tight budget.

Delivering excellent mid-range performance, the ThermoPro TP20 is the best value meat thermometer for BBQ, combining dual-probe wireless tech at a fraction of premium costs. Ideal for smoking sessions, the transmitter monitors meat up to 572°F and grill up to 716°F, with a 300-foot range and dual backlit screens for easy outdoor reading. Pre-programmed for eight meats, it includes USDA doneness targets and countdown timers to time your rests perfectly.
Pros: Long 300-hour battery life, magnetic base for grill attachment, and high accuracy. Cons: No app integration, so alerts are receiver-only.
This is great for value-seeking BBQ enthusiasts who want reliable remote monitoring without breaking the bank.

As the best premium meat thermometer for BBQ, the FireBoard 2 Drive offers pro-grade features for competition-level cooks, with six probes and unlimited WiFi range via cloud connectivity. Perfect for low-and-slow BBQ, it tracks hyper-accurate temps (±1°F) up to 700°F, integrates with smart grills like Traeger, and provides real-time graphs plus voice alerts through its intuitive app.
Pros: Robust build, fan-powered cooling for probes, and advanced data logging for recipe tweaking. Cons: Steep learning curve and premium price may overwhelm casual users.
Choose this if you're a dedicated pitmaster investing in a high-end meat thermometer for BBQ that grows with your skills.

The Inkbird IBBQ-4T excels in multi-probe BBQ monitoring, making it a top pick for complex cooks like whole hog or multi-rack ribs. With four probes—two for meat and two for ambient—it tracks multiple temps simultaneously via Bluetooth, sending app alerts up to 300 feet away. Designed for BBQ's endurance, it handles up to 572°F probe temps and 716°F ambient, with a 12-hour rechargeable battery for overnight smokes.
Pros: Customizable alarms, graphing app, and versatile for grills or ovens. Cons: Setup can be fiddly for beginners, and probes aren't as durable in extreme heat.
Opt for this if you run large BBQ spreads and need a wireless meat thermometer for BBQ that manages chaos without missing a beat.

The ThermoWorks Smoke Gateway is a BBQ powerhouse for remote monitoring, turning your smoker into a smart setup with Bluetooth/WiFi probes that reach 716°F. Its rugged design suits outdoor BBQ rigors, with two probes for meat and ambient temps, and an app that delivers push notifications, historical charts, and custom alarms—essential for unattended long cooks like pulled pork.
Pros: Pro accuracy, weatherproof case, and seamless iOS/Android compatibility. Cons: Requires gateway for full WiFi, adding to setup complexity.
Ideal for tech-savvy BBQ pros who demand a versatile meat thermometer for extended sessions.

For speed demons in BBQ, the Thermapen ONE delivers the fastest 1-second reads, making it indispensable for quick checks on searing steaks or rotisserie chicken. Its Type-K thermocouple probe auto-rotates for easy insertion in tight grill spots, with a 3.5-inch length and IP67 waterproof rating to withstand BBQ splashes and heat up to 572°F.
Pros: Unmatched speed and ±0.5°F accuracy, auto-off, and motion-sensing display. Cons: No wireless features, so it's hands-on only for monitoring.
This instant-read meat thermometer for BBQ suits grillers who prioritize precision over remote tech.

The Weber iGrill Mini is a compact, app-connected gem for Weber grill owners, focusing on seamless BBQ integration with a single probe that monitors up to 716°F via Bluetooth (225-foot range). Its magnetic mount sticks right to your grill, and the app offers eight meat presets with guided cook times, perfect for backyard BBQs without overwhelming features.
Pros: Affordable wireless entry, easy pairing, and timer integration. Cons: Limited to one probe, not suited for multi-item smokes.
Pick this for simple, grill-specific meat thermometer needs in casual BBQ setups.
